Das Konzept des Quality Function Deployment (QFD) setzt mit Hilfe einer Reihe von Matrizen Kundenwünsche in Konstruktions- oder Designerfordernisse um. Die Konstruktions- und Designerfordernisse wiederum werden umgesetzt in Produkt- bzw. Teilprodukteigenschaften, die ihrerseits wieder auf Produktionsprozesse und anschließend auf spezielle Prozeß- und Steuerungsmechanismen übertragen werden. Dieses Buch wendet das QFD Konzept auf eine Reihe von unternehmerischen Schlüsselthemen an, die bislang unbehandelt geblieben sind, wie z. B. ISO9000, Service Design, Robust Design und Software Design. Das Buch wird mit Begleitdiskette geliefert, die mit der entsprechenden QFD Software ausgestattet ist. (11/97)

Quality function deployment (QFD) is an effective tool to help organizations become more competitive by designing their products and services to satisfy cutomers' requirements. The manager is guided on a step-by-step process to attaining this goal. This book is precise and direct and focuses on key issues in building the House of Quality otherwise known as QFD. By reading this book, the manager understands how to solicit customer requirement information, how design requirements are matched to customer requirements, how weights are assigned, how priorities are developed, and how activities can be benchmarked. The manager also understands how to solve the critical problems that help achieve customer satisfaction. This book also guides the reader to understand how companywide quality activities are related to QFD. This link is often lacking in other presentations of QFD that often fail to show the linkage between QFD and other quality initiatives and management programs.
